375.09 ALL PURPOSE VEHICLES, TRAIL BIKES AND DIRT BIKES PROHIBITED.
   (a)   Definition of All-Purpose Vehicle. “All-purpose vehicle.” Any self-propelled vehicle designed primarily for cross-country travel on land and water, or no more than one type of terrain, and steered by wheels or caterpillar treads, or any combination thereof, including vehicles that operate on a cushion of air, vehicles commonly known as all-terrain vehicles, all season vehicles, mini-bikes and trail bikes. The term does not include a utility vehicle as defined in Ohio R.C. 4501.01 or any vehicle principally used in playing golf, any motor vehicle or aircraft required to be registered under Ohio R.C. Chapter 4503 or Ohio R.C. Chapter 4561, and any vehicle excepted from definition as a motor vehicle by Ohio R.C. 4501.01(B).
   
   (b)   Operation of All-Purpose Vehicles Prohibited.
      (1)   The operation and use of all purpose vehicles, trail bikes, dirt bikes are hereby prohibited within the corporate limits of the Municipality, both on private and public lands, except in locations where the operation is more than 500 feet from the nearest residence.
      (2)   Nothing contained in this section shall prevent the Municipality from regulating the operation of the vehicles mentioned in division (a) of this section in case of an emergency.
      (3)   Any parent or guardian who authorizes or knowingly permits a child or ward to violate any provision of this section shall be punished as a principal offender and sentenced pursuant to division (d) of this section.
      (4)   Whoever violates this section is guilty of a minor misdemeanor for a first offense and a misdemeanor of the fourth degree for a second offense.
         (Ord. 2019-06. Passed 3-4-19.)
